/**
* Wrapper to the SCORM API provided by Chamilo
* The complete set of functions and variables are in this file to avoid unnecessary file
* accesses.
* Only event triggers and answer data are inserted into the final document.
* @author Yannick Warnier - inspired by the ADLNet documentation on SCORM content-side API
* @package scorm.js
*/
/**
* Initialisation of the SCORM API section.
* Find the SCO functions (startTimer, computeTime, etc in the second section)
* Find the Chamilo-proper functions (checkAnswers, etc in the third section)
*/
var _debug = true;
var findAPITries = 0;
var _apiHandle = null; //private variable
var errMsgLocate = "Unable to locate the LMS's API implementation";
var _NoError = 0;
var _GeneralException = 101;
var _ServerBusy = 102;
var _InvalidArgumentError = 201;
var _ElementCannotHaveChildren = 202;
var _ElementIsNotAnArray = 203;
var _NotInitialized = 301;
var _NotImplementedError = 401;
var _InvalidSetValue = 402;
var _ElementIsReadOnly = 403;
var _ElementIsWriteOnly = 404;
var _IncorrectDataType = 405;
var startTime;
var exitPageStatus;
/**
* Gets the API handle right into the local API object and ensure there is only one.
* Using the singleton pattern to ensure there's only one API object.
* @return object The API object as given by the LMS
*/
var API = new function()
{
if (_apiHandle == null) {
_apiHandle = getAPI();
}
return _apiHandle;
}
/**
* Finds the API on the LMS side or gives up giving an error message
* @param object The window/frame object in which we are searching for the SCORM API
* @return object The API object recovered from the LMS's implementation of the SCORM API
*/
function findAPI(win)
{
while((win.API == null) && (win.parent != null) && (win.parent != win)) {
findAPITries++;
if (findAPITries>10) {
alert("Error finding API - too deeply nested");
return null;
}
win = win.parent
}
return win.API;
}
/**
* Gets the API from the current window/frame or from parent objects if not found
* @return object The API object recovered from the LMS's implementation of the SCORM API
*/
function getAPI()
{
//window is the global/root object of the current window/frame
var MyAPI = findAPI(window);
//look through parents if any
if ((MyAPI == null) && (window.opener != null) && (typeof(window.opener) != "undefined")) {
MyAPI = findAPI(window.opener);
}
//still not found? error message
if (MyAPI == null) {
alert("Unable to find SCORM API adapter.\nPlease check your LMS is considering this page as SCORM and providing the right JavaScript interface.")
}
return MyAPI;
}

/**
* Calls the LMSInitialize method of the LMS's API object
* @return string The string value of the LMS returned value or false if error (should be "true" otherwise)
*/
function doLMSInitialize()
{
if (API == null) {
alert(errMsgLocate + "\nLMSInitialize failed");
return false;
}
var result = API.LMSInitialize("");
if (result.toString() != "true") {
var err = errorHandler();
}
return result.toString();
}
/**
* Calls the LMSFinish method of the LMS's API object
* @return string The string value of the LMS return value, or false if error (should be "true" otherwise)
*/
function doLMSFinish()
{
if (API == null) {
alert(errMsgLocate + "\nLMSFinish failed");
return false;
} else {
var result = API.LMSFinish('');
if (result.toString() != "true") {
var err = errorHandler();
}
}
return result.toString();
}
/**
* Calls the LMSGetValue method
* @param string The name of the SCORM parameter to get
* @return string The value returned by the LMS
*/
function doLMSGetValue(name)
{
if (API == null) {
alert(errMsgLocate + "\nLMSGetValue was not successful.");
return '';
} else {
var value = API.LMSGetValue(name);
var errCode = API.LMSGetLastError().toString();
if (errCode != _NoError) {
// an error was encountered so display the error description
var errDescription = API.LMSGetErrorString(errCode);
addDebug("LMSGetValue(" + name + ") failed. \n" + errDescription)
return '';
}
return value.toString();
}
}
/**
* Calls the LMSSetValue method of the API object
* @param string The name of the SCORM parameter to set
* @param string The value to set the parameter to
* @return void
*/
function doLMSSetValue(name, value)
{
if (API == null) {
alert("Unable to locate the LMS's API Implementation.\nLMSSetValue was not successful.");
return;
} else {
var result = API.LMSSetValue(name, value);
if (result.toString() != "true") {
var err = errorHandler();
}
}
return;
}

/**
* Initialise page values
*/
function loadPage()
{
var result = doLMSInitialize();
if (result) {
var status = doLMSGetValue("cmi.core.lesson_status");
if (status == "not attempted") {
doLMSSetValue("cmi.core.lesson_status", "incomplete");
}
exitPageStatus = false;
startTimer();
}
}
/**
* Starts the local timer
*/
function startTimer()
{
startTime = new Date().getTime();
}
/**
* Calculates the total time and sends the result to the LMS
*/
function computeTime()
{
if (startTime != 0) {
var currentDate = new Date().getTime();
var elapsedSeconds = ( (currentDate - startTime) / 1000 );
var formattedTime = convertTotalSeconds(elapsedSeconds);
} else {
formattedTime = "00:00:00.0";
}
doLMSSetValue( "cmi.core.session_time", formattedTime );
}
/**
* Formats the time in a SCORM time format
*/
function convertTotalSeconds(ts)
{
var sec = (ts % 60);
ts -= sec;
var tmp = (ts % 3600); //# of seconds in the total # of minutes
ts -= tmp; //# of seconds in the total # of hours
// convert seconds to conform to CMITimespan type (e.g. SS.00)
sec = Math.round(sec*100)/100;
var strSec = new String(sec);
var strWholeSec = strSec;
var strFractionSec = "";
if (strSec.indexOf(".") != -1) {
strWholeSec = strSec.substring(0, strSec.indexOf("."));
strFractionSec = strSec.substring(strSec.indexOf(".") + 1, strSec.length);
}
if (strWholeSec.length < 2) {
strWholeSec = "0" + strWholeSec;
}
strSec = strWholeSec;
if (strFractionSec.length) {
strSec = strSec + "." + strFractionSec;
}
if ((ts % 3600) != 0)
var hour = 0;
else var hour = (ts / 3600);
if ((tmp % 60) != 0)
var min = 0;
else var min = (tmp / 60);
if ((new String(hour)).length < 2)
hour = "0" + hour;
if ((new String(min)).length < 2)
min = "0" + min;
var rtnVal = hour + ":" + min + ":" + strSec;
return rtnVal
}
